Let x=3.77777777...
 10x=37.777777777...
9x=10x-x=34
9x=34 so x=34/9=3 7/9

Answer:
y = 2(x-3)^2 - 2 
Step-by-step explanation:
y = 2x^2 - 12x + 16 
y = 2(x^2 - 6x + 8) 
y = 2(x^2 - 6x +8 +1 -1) you "complete the square" by bringing the last term (8) up to "half of the middle co-efficient squared". Middle co-efficient is -6, half is -3, squared is 9. To get from 8 to 9 you must add 1 (+1), but if you add 1 you must subtract 1 (-1) so that you don't change the overall value of inside the bracket
y = 2(x^2 - 6x +9) - 2 (bring the -1 outside of the brackets) 
y = 2(x-3)^2 - 2
